Transaction 3dc0312f6e847c3a05cf45b792a2e02f69744254a21fca8836bd3775b3f98a13
4 Input
2 Outputs
- 3dc0312f6e847c3a05cf45b792a2e02f69744254a21fca8836bd3775b3f98a13:0
- 3dc0312f6e847c3a05cf45b792a2e02f69744254a21fca8836bd3775b3f98a13:1
value 945711
address 1DEDbccHZ7BDnAbAH4CF84grpRQcFujaBX
value 4811611
address 18E1dX7QJyaBbUptmGuTb1sPAvBRNNj7pd